Grass Valley, established in 1959 in Grass Valley, California, is a leading manufacturer of television production and broadcasting equipment. The company offers a comprehensive range of products, including cameras, live production switchers, replay and highlights systems, media storage solutions, editing tools, asset management software, modular infrastructure, routing and conversion equipment, control systems, monitoring tools, and automated playout solutions. These products are available as hardware, software, and software-as-a-service (SaaS) offerings. In 2014, Grass Valley merged with Miranda Technologies, both of which were acquired by Belden Inc. in 2014 and 2012, respectively. In February 2018, Belden merged Grass Valley with Snell Advanced Media (formerly known as Quantel Ltd, Snell, Snell & Wilcox, Snell Limited, SAM, and Snell Group). On July 2, 2020, Grass Valley was acquired by Black Dragon Capital, a private equity firm specializing in media and technology investments. This acquisition marked a significant shift in Grass Valley's ownership, positioning the company for future growth and innovation in the media production industry. The company's headquarters are located in Montreal, Quebec, Canada, and its products are manufactured in multiple countries to meet global demand.
